How to Set Up a New iPhone
Setting up a new iPhone involves a few straightforward steps to personalize your device and get it connected to your apps and data. Let’s dive into these steps to get your iPhone ready to use.
Step 1: Turn on Your iPhone
Press and hold the power button until the Apple logo appears.
Turning on your iPhone is the first step to bringing it to life. This allows you to start the initial setup process. Once you see the Apple logo, your phone is booting up and getting ready for your input.
Step 2: Follow the On-Screen Instructions
Select your language and region from the options provided.
These settings help customize your phone for local services and languages. By choosing your language and region, your iPhone will offer the most relevant keyboard and apps tailored to your location.
Step 3: Connect to Wi-Fi
Choose a Wi-Fi network and enter the password if required.
Connecting to Wi-Fi ensures that your iPhone can download necessary setup information and updates. A stable connection is crucial for a smooth setup experience and for restoring data from iCloud if needed.
Step 4: Set Up Face ID or Touch ID
Follow the prompts to configure Face ID or Touch ID for security.
Setting up Face ID or Touch ID adds an extra layer of security to your device. This biometric authentication method ensures that only you can unlock your phone and access sensitive data.
Step 5: Sign in with Your Apple ID
Enter your Apple ID and password to access all Apple services.
Your Apple ID is your gateway to Apple’s ecosystem. By signing in, you can download apps, access iCloud, and sync your data across devices. If you don’t have an Apple ID, you can create one during this step.
Step 6: Choose Your Data Transfer Method
Select how you want to transfer apps and data from your old device.
Whether using iCloud backup, a direct device-to-device transfer, or setting up as new, this step helps you get all your favorite apps and settings onto your new iPhone. Choose the method that works best for you.
Once you’ve completed these steps, your iPhone will finalize the setup process. You’ll have the option to explore settings, download apps, and personalize your device further. Your new iPhone is now ready for use!
Tips for Setting Up a New iPhone
- Keep your old device handy for easy data transfer.
- Ensure your new iPhone is fully charged before starting.
- Update your old device to the latest iOS version to streamline data transfer.
- Consider setting up Family Sharing to manage family devices and purchases.
- Enable ‘Find My iPhone’ for added security in case your device is lost or stolen.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I skip setting up Face ID or Touch ID?
Yes, you can skip this step and set it up later in the Settings app. However, it’s recommended for enhanced security.
What if I don’t have an Apple ID?
You can create a new Apple ID during the setup process. It’s necessary for accessing Apple services and the App Store.
Can I transfer data from an Android phone?
Yes, you can use the "Move to iOS" app to transfer data from an Android device to your new iPhone.
How do I set up email accounts on my new iPhone?
You can add email accounts in the Settings app under ‘Mail’ by selecting ‘Accounts’ and then ‘Add Account.’
What should I do if my iPhone doesn’t turn on?
Ensure it’s charged and try a force restart by pressing the power and volume down buttons simultaneously.
